FY2017 Hypothetical Small Area FMRs For Sussex County, NJ

In metropolitan areas, HUD defines Small Areas using ZIP Codes within the metropolitan area. Using ZIP codes as the basis for FMRs provides tenants with greater ability to move into ?Opportunity Neighborhoods? with jobs, public transportation, and good schools. They also provide for multiple payment standards within a metropolitan area, and they are likely to reduce need for extensive market area rent reasonableness studies. Lastly, HUD hopes that setting FMRs for each ZIP code will reduce overpayment in lower-rent areas.

Sussex County is part of the New York-Newark-Jersey City, NY-NJ-PA MSA.
